This spring, Forged in Fire, written and performed by Hope North Uganda founder, Okello Kelo Sam, will be coming to the Voorhees Theater at NYCCT.

Forged in Fire cleverly uses music, dance, humor, and song to explore Okello’s own personal experiences of the civil war in Northern Uganda. Proceeds from the performances will benefit the students of Hope North. (see Hope North sub-tab for more information.)
